Tenmat cavity fire barriers – age testing confirms working life of 60 years
Independent third-party testing shows that all grades of active intumescent components used in Tenmat cavity fire barriers have a working life of 60 years.

How to pick the right Intumescent for your project Intumescents are technologically advanced passive fire protection materials. Intumescents are typically used in construction to maintain or reinstate the fire resistance of buildings, in floors, walls and ceilings.
